Subject: [PATCH 1/4] kdump: add crashkernel cma suffix
Date: Fri, 24 Nov 2023 20:57:49 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<ZWEAPXiCCgAf1WrY@dwarf.suse.cz>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<ZWD_fAPqEWkFlEkM@dwarf.suse.cz>
Add a new optional ",cma" suffix to the crashkernel= command line option.
Add a new cma_size parameter to parse_crashkernel().
When not NULL, call __parse_crashkernel to parse the CMA
reservation size from "crashkernel=size,cma" and store it
in cma_size.
Set cma_size to NULL in all calls to parse_crashkernel().

diff --git a/include/linux/crash_core.h b/include/linux/crash_core.h
index 5126a4fecb44..f1edefcf7377 100644
--- a/include/linux/crash_core.h
+++ b/include/linux/crash_core.h
@@ -95,7 +95,8 @@ void final_note(Elf_Word *buf);
int __init parse_crashkernel(char *cmdline, unsigned long long system_ram,
unsigned long long *crash_size, unsigned long long *crash_base,
- unsigned long long *low_size, bool *high);
+ unsigned long long *low_size, unsigned long long *cma_size,
+ bool *high);
#ifdef CONFIG_ARCH_HAS_GENERIC_CRASHKERNEL_RESERVATION
#ifndef DEFAULT_CRASH_KERNEL_LOW_SIZE
diff --git a/kernel/crash_core.c b/kernel/crash_core.c
index efe87d501c8c..1e952d2e451b 100644
--- a/kernel/crash_core.c
+++ b/kernel/crash_core.c
@@ -184,11 +184,13 @@ static int __init parse_crashkernel_simple(char *cmdline,
#define SUFFIX_HIGH 0
#define SUFFIX_LOW 1
-#define SUFFIX_NULL 2
+#define SUFFIX_CMA 2
+#define SUFFIX_NULL 3
static __initdata char *suffix_tbl[] = {
- [SUFFIX_HIGH] = ",high",
- [SUFFIX_LOW] = ",low",
- [SUFFIX_NULL] = NULL,
+ [SUFFIX_HIGH] = ",high",
+ [SUFFIX_LOW] = ",low",
+ [SUFFIX_CMA] = ",cma",
+ [SUFFIX_NULL] = NULL,
};
/*
@@ -310,9 +312,11 @@ int __init parse_crashkernel(char *cmdline,
unsigned long long *crash_size,
unsigned long long *crash_base,
unsigned long long *low_size,
+ unsigned long long *cma_size,
bool *high)
{
int ret;
+ unsigned long long cma_base;
/* crashkernel=X[@offset] */
ret = __parse_crashkernel(cmdline, system_ram, crash_size,
@@ -343,6 +347,14 @@ int __init parse_crashkernel(char *cmdline,
*high = true;
}
+
+ /*
+ * optional CMA reservation
+ * cma_base is ignored
+ */
+ if (cma_size)
+ __parse_crashkernel(cmdline, 0, cma_size,
+ &cma_base, suffix_tbl[SUFFIX_CMA]);
#endif
if (!*crash_size)
ret = -EINVAL;
